The station is designed to make your journey as smooth as possible. Although there isn't a ticket office on site, fear not, as ticket vending machines are readily available for collecting pre-purchased tickets. These machines, however, lack accessibility features. Should you require further assistance, customer help points are positioned strategically throughout the site. Keep in mind that if you require detailed staff assistance, it would be advisable to plan ahead since there are no staff help available at the station.
For those concerned about accessibility, the station is classified as category 'A', meaning it offers step-free access to all platforms. You can also find a helpful ramp for train access and an induction loop for those with hearing impairments. However, some facilities such as toilets, accessible toilets, and baby changing areas are not available.
Although there are no retail outlets within the station, you won't be left wanting when it comes to adjacent infrastructure. Cyclists will be pleased to find sheltered bicycle racks right next to the entrance, under the watchful eye of CCTV. Bicycle hire services are on offer too, providing a green option for onward travel.
Stratford-upon-Avon Parkway's transport links make it easy to continue with your journey. Bus services are available for those looking to make their way to Stratford-upon-Avon town centre, particularly through the Park & Ride scheme. Additionally, in the event of rail service disruptions, replacement buses are planned to operate directly from the station's forecourt next to the entrance.

Shelford (Cambs) train station stands as a small but reliable station in the village of Great Shelford, in Cambridgeshire. Not only does it serve the local community, but it's also a key departure point for travelers venturing into the city or escaping into the countryside. Whether you're a local or just passing through, you're sure to find this charming station equipped with essential amenities to ensure a smooth journey.
When it comes to ticket buying, Shelford (Cambs) provides a smooth experience. The ticket office operates Monday through Friday from 6:00 AM to 10:30 AM. Fortunately, if you miss that window, ticket machines are available around-the-clock. These are equipped to dispense tickets bought online and are accessible for everyone, with induction loops in place for those with hearing needs.
Although the station lacks some modern features like CCTV and refreshment facilities, it does provide essential travel information such as departure and arrival screens and public announcements, ensuring you're always in the know. Waiting rooms are open during the same hours as the ticket office, though they are only available on Platform 1. It's important to note that there are no toilets or baby changing facilities.
Shelford station strives to be inclusive, with some step-free access and accessible ticket machines. However, it's vital to be aware that platforms are narrow, which can pose challenges for mobility scooters. In these cases, ramps are available for easy train access, and customer assistance can be booked in advance using the Passenger Assist service.
For those needing onward transport, Shelford offers convenient connections. The station is serviced by local buses, and during times of rail disruption, a replacement bus service operates from a stop directly outside the station entrance.
